DEVICE FOR TAKING MEASUREMENTS REMOTELY OF THE RADIATIVE FLUX OF AN ENERGY SOURCE

摘要

One subject of the present invention is a device (1) for taking absolute measurements remotely of the radiative flux (21) of an energy source (2), which is able to have a response time lower than 10 ns in dynamic regime. The device (1) according to the invention comprises a transparent substrate (3) and a photothermal transducer (4). The transducer (4) combines an absorbing material (41) consisting of an opaque carpet of carbon nanotubes that is supported on its back side (412) by the substrate (3), an achromatic optical device (42) and a fast infrared detector (43). Another subject of the present invention is a method for taking measurements remotely of the radiative flux of a source in dynamic regime employing the device according to the invention.
